Introduction: The world of aviation has always been fascinated by the idea of flight. Pilots, in particular, possess a unique passion for soaring through the skies and constantly seek ways to push the boundaries of their craft. In recent years, a remarkable trend has emerged within the pilots' community: the rise of DIY aircraft. In this blog post, we will delve into the growing enthusiasm for building and flying homemade airplanes within the pilots' community. 1. The Thrill of Building Your Own Aircraft: For pilots, the excitement of constructing their own aircraft is equivalent to a chef crafting a gourmet meal from scratch. The process appeals to their love for aviation and provides an unparalleled understanding of the workings of an airplane. DIY aircraft enthusiasts often take pride in customizing their flying machines to suit their specific needs, ensuring every inch is tailored to perfection. 2. The Sense of Community: The pilots' community is known for its camaraderie and the passion they share for flight. This community spirit extends to the world of DIY aircraft, fostering encouraging environments where pilots exchange knowledge, expertise, and experiences. Online forums, social media groups, and aviation events dedicated to DIY aircraft provide platforms for pilots to connect, ask questions, and share their progress, ultimately creating a strong sense of community within the aviation sphere. 3. Overcoming Challenges and Learning Opportunities: Building a DIY aircraft is no easy feat; it requires a multidisciplinary approach that encompasses engineering, mechanics, and safety regulations. However, these challenges serve as valuable learning opportunities for pilots, enabling them to deepen their understanding of aeronautics and gain a holistic perspective on aviation. Learning from experienced builders and aviation professionals who are part of the pilots' community ensures that safety standards are maintained throughout the DIY aircraft project. 4. Innovations in Design and Technology: The pioneers of the DIY aircraft movement are often driven by the desire to innovate and explore unconventional design concepts. With advancements in technology and access to a wide range of engineering resources, pilots have the freedom to experiment with cutting-edge materials and aerodynamic principles. This pursuit of innovation not only fuels their creativity but also contributes to advancements in aircraft design, benefitting the wider aviation industry. 5. Legal and Safety Considerations: While the allure of building your own aircraft is undeniable, pilots within the DIY aircraft community are well aware of the legal and safety considerations that come with this endeavor. Adhering to aviation regulations, consulting with experts, and acquiring the necessary certifications are vital aspects of this process. The pilots' community plays a pivotal role in sharing best practices, ensuring that DIY aircraft builders prioritize safety and legality at all stages of their project. Conclusion: The pilots' community's embrace of DIY aircraft is a testament to the unwavering passion for flight that drives these aviation enthusiasts. Building and flying their homemade airplanes allows pilots to push boundaries, learn valuable skills, and foster a strong sense of community among like-minded individuals. As the DIY aircraft movement continues to gain momentum, it undoubtedly adds a unique dimension to the ever-evolving world of aviation.
